re: Cool Drives within 150 km from Bangalore

Did the 1 day trip to Talakadu in the last week of Dec 2015.

Route followed:
Regular BLR-Mysore highway till Maddur -> Malavalli -> Talakadu

The stretch between Maddur and Malavalli has all kinds of road conditions.
Just after you exit the highway at Maddur, the road is bumpy, with potholes having been recently filled with uneven dollops of tar.
Then it deteriorates to the point of being a mud road, with bi-directional traffic being pushed into one lane, due to ongoing road work on the adjacent lane.
There are some stretches where road widening has been completed and these can be covered very quickly.
In other stretches, one half of the road has been completed, while work on the other half is ongoing and bi-directional traffic gets onto this single completed lane.
In many places, there is almost a 1 foot difference in height between adjacent lanes of the road (one being the completed lane and the other being the one where work is ongoing)
IMO, it is best to avoid night driving on this stretch due to the current road condition.

After Malavalli, Google maps suggests a deviation from NH 209 onto a village road. Route link.
This stretch of road is very good for the first few KMs after leaving NH 209 and then deteriorates rapidly and becomes rather agonizing till the point where it hits the Belakavadi to T-Narasipura road.
There is some road work ongoing on this stretch, but doesn't look like it is going to complete anytime soon, as there was no machinery apart from a digger on this entire stretch.
After rejoining the Belakavadi to T-Narasipura road, the drive quality improves again and remains good till Talakadu.

There are no decent food joints or restrooms anywhere after you exit from the BLR-Mysore highway
The Talakadu river bank was a nice place for kids to enjoy, but quite crowded.

Wasn't aware of the existence of other route options so took the same route on the way back also and suffered the same broken road between Belakavady - T-Narasipura road and Malavalli.

For someone else who is visiting, it might be worth checking if either of:
1] Malavalli to Talakadu road via Kyathanahalli and Mallinathpura. Route link
2] NH 209 -> Belakavadi -> T-Narasipura to Belakavadi road -> Talakadu (a slightly longer route). Route link.

have better road conditions than the shorter route suggested by Google maps

Actually this turn off towards Bannur is a couple of kilometers before you get to the first Cauvery bridge at Srirangapatna. There is a rather big village with quite a few shops, a bank etc (Baburayanakoppal) a few hundred meters after you cross this junction, and the Cauvery bridge comes about 1 km after that. Can't recall any specific landmark at this junction, but I think there is a board there with marking for Somanathapura and possibly Talakad as @mpksuhas mentioned.
